Hey小伙伴们,今天要和大家分享一个超级实用的技能——在服务器上跑HTML!🚀 你有没有想过,自己的网页可以24小时在线,随时供人访问?这不仅仅是个梦想,今天就来教你如何实现它!
我们需要一台服务器,这里说的服务器,可以是云服务器,也可以是你自己搭建的物理服务器,云服务器的好处是方便、快捷,而且可以按需付费,非常适合初学者和中小企业使用。🌐
我们要安装Web服务器软件,这里有两个非常流行的选择:Apache和Nginx,Apache是一个开源的Web服务器软件,功能强大,安装简单,Nginx则是一个高性能的Web服务器,以其高并发处理能力而闻名。🛠️
安装好Web服务器之后,我们需要配置它,配置文件通常位于服务器的特定目录下,比如Apache的配置文件通常是httpd.conf
,而Nginx的是nginx.conf
,在配置文件中,我们需要指定网站的根目录,也就是存放HTML文件的地方。📂
我们要把HTML文件上传到服务器,这可以通过FTP、SCP或者直接通过服务器的管理界面来完成,确保你的HTML文件放在配置文件中指定的根目录下。📁
上传完成后,我们需要确保服务器的防火墙设置允许HTTP和HTTPS流量,这样,外部的访问请求才能到达你的服务器。🔥
一切准备就绪,我们可以启动Web服务器了,对于Apache,你可以使用命令sudo service apache2 start
(具体命令可能因操作系统而异),对于Nginx,命令通常是sudo service nginx start
。🚀
启动服务器后,我们需要检查一下是否能够通过浏览器访问你的HTML页面,在浏览器地址栏输入你的服务器IP地址或者绑定的域名,看看是否能看到你的网页内容,如果一切顺利,那么恭喜你,你的HTML页面已经成功在服务器上运行了!🎉
如果遇到问题,不要担心,检查一下服务器的日志文件,看看是否有错误信息,常见的问题可能有配置错误、文件权限问题或者防火墙设置不当,根据错误信息,逐一排查和解决。🔍
别忘了定期更新你的Web服务器软件和操作系统,以确保安全和性能,也要关注你的网站流量和性能,根据需要调整服务器配置,以提供更好的用户体验。🛡️
好了,今天的分享就到这里,是不是觉得在服务器上跑HTML其实也没那么难?动手试试吧,你也能拥有自己的在线网页!如果你有任何疑问或者想要进一步探讨,随时欢迎交流哦!🌟
还没有评论,来说两句吧...